Default Tire Questions

I have just bought a new Leopard and I have a few questions:

1. Are there any other tires that will fit on the Leopard wheels?
2. Options other than F1 tires for on-road PERFORMANCE
3. How tall and wide are the carson MT wheel/tires (inches please)
4. What are you Leopard/Marder race owners using
5. I am considering 40 series 23mm hub wheels with road rage tires, Better ideas?
6. Availability of mt slicks? (stadium truck type)

Any help or sugestions would be appreciated.

Default RE: Tire Questions

Several options are available....
1. 1/6 Scale Slick or Treaded tires (these are used on the Hard Baller Turcks) 1/6 scale On-Road Semi trucks. The tires are about .5" larger in DIA vs the stock 1/5 scale on road tires.
2. the 40 series tires.... but they are still too small they don't look proportional
3. Duratrax/XTM pin spike tires are great cheap and they do the job for off road.


I prefer the 1/6 scale slick tires on my MT5 or the monster truck tires. But i have re-geard my truck to a 40/22 using a 50T rear ring gear. I am geard like an onroad car due to the NOS kits hard hitting action and to prevent the motor from over reving every time you hit the NOS.

but off road the duratrax tires are cheap to trash around and the 1/6 scale slicks are good for on road use.

40 series is great but it just does not look right it's still too small... the IMEX jumbo kong tires are decent to use also just get the correct rim for it.

Default RE: Tire Questions

If anyone is interested stock REVO tires will fit the buggy race (wide) wheels with a little effort. The buggy wheels are almost the same diameter as revo rims and 40 series rims; the problem with 40 series tires is they are too wide to seat properly. I worry about the durability; I will report my findings as possible.
